Primary HB 2610
In committee · Oregon House · Lead sponsor
Relating to transient lodging health inspections.

Requires Oregon Health Authority to establish program for periodic health inspection of hotel or inn guest facilities. Requires hotel or inn to post most recent health inspection results. Makes failure to post results violation subject to civil penalty, not to exceed $1,000.

Primary HB 2310
In committee · Oregon House · Lead sponsor
Relating to a workforce development pilot program; declaring an emergency.

Establishes Prosperity 1,000 Pilot Program to provide career coaching, occupational training and job placement services for at least 1,000 low-income job seekers residing in areas of concentrated poverty. Appropriates moneys from General Fund to Department of Human Services for biennium beginning July 1, 2019. Sunsets January 2, 2024. Declares emergency, effective July 1, 2019.

Co-sponsor HB 3060
In committee · Oregon House · Co-sponsor
Relating to transfers of human fetal tissue.

Prohibits person from soliciting or knowingly acquiring, receiving, transporting, implanting, processing, preserving, storing or accepting donation of human fetal tissue for purpose of transplanting the human fetal tissue into another person or animal under specified circumstances. Punishes by maximum of five years' imprisonment, $125,000 fine, or both. Establishes Teen Pregnancy Assistance Fund and requires prosecuting attorney to deposit proceeds of fines for violation of Act into fund. Continuously appropriates moneys in fund to Department of Education for sole purpose of providing financial assistance to girls who are enrolled in high school in this state, have had child while enrolled in high school and need financial aid for expenses connected with obtaining high school diploma.

Primary SB 747
In committee · Oregon Senate · Lead sponsor
Relating to the TriMet Crash Advisory Committee.

Establishes TriMet Crash Advisory Committee. Provides that committee shall review certain crashes involving TriMet vehicles that result in injury or fatality. Requires committee to assess causes of such crashes, make recommendations to prevent similar crashes and submit quarterly report on findings to Transportation Safety Committee. Requires TriMet to provide meeting space and staff support to TriMet Crash Advisory Committee.

Co-sponsor HB 2968
In committee · Oregon House · Co-sponsor
Relating to promoting prostitution.

Modifies crime of promoting prostitution to include knowingly recruiting, persuading or encouraging, or attempting to recruit, persuade or encourage, another person to engage in prostitution. Punishes by maximum of 5 years' imprisonment, $125,000 fine, or both.

Primary HB 2897
In committee · Oregon House · Lead sponsor
Relating to grants for early childhood programs; prescribing an effective date.

Establishes Early Childhood Equity Fund. Authorizes Early Learning Division to make grants from fund for purpose of supporting culturally specific early learning, early childhood and parent support programs in this state and to promote capacity of culturally specific organizations to deliver programs . Takes effect on 91st day following adjournment sine die.
